Abstract
The utility model discloses a mounting structure of [electric] motor coach battery box, the frame construction who constitutes including bottom plate (1) and side shield (2), backplate (3), the upper surface of bottom plate (1), side shield (2) and backplate (3) common holding chamber that is used for placing the battery box that forms be provided with guide way (4) on bottom plate (1), protruding (13) phase -matchs of this guide way (4) and battery box (12), the front end of guide way (5) is described for sealing for opening form, rear end it is provided with running roller (5) to set up on bottom plate (1) to arrange. The utility model discloses a set up the guide way on the bottom plate, protruding phase -match on guide way and the battery box, when installing the battery box, the guide way can play the effect of direction and location, prevents that the battery box from putting askewly, in addition, through setting up the running roller on the bottom plate, only need very little thrust to push up when moving the battery box at the bottom plate, make things convenient for the installation of battery box.
Description
Technical field
This utility model relates to the mounting structure of a kind of battery box for electric passenger car, belongs to technical field of automobile.
Background technology
At present, due to the rise of the enhancing of environmental consciousness of people and electric automobile, increasing automobile vendor payes attention to producing electric automobile.In present urban public transport, electric motor coach progressively comes into operation, and replaces traditional fuel oil passenger vehicle, to reach environmental protection and to save the purpose of the energy.
Electrokinetic cell is the important component part of electric motor coach, and the effect of battery case is the electrokinetic cell for placing electric automobile.The electrokinetic cell volume used due to electric motor coach is big, quality weight, causes required battery case bulky, after electrokinetic cell is placed on battery case inside so that whole casing quality weight.
The existing mounting structure of battery box for electric passenger car usually adopts simple frame structure, is directly fixedly mounted in this frame structure by battery case.Owing to existing frame structure is not provided with corresponding guiding-positioning structure, the installation site of battery case it is difficult to ensure that, it is easy to fill askew.It addition, when carrying out battery case installation, owing to battery case volume is big and quality weight, operator is difficult to promote battery case to move in frame structure, causes installation difficulty.
Utility model content
The technical problems to be solved in the utility model is: provide the mounting structure of a kind of battery box for electric passenger car, facilitates battery case to promote in this mounting structure, can ensure that the placement direction of battery case and position simultaneously so that the simple installation of battery case, reliable.
The purpose of this utility model is achieved through the following technical solutions:
A kind of mounting structure of battery box for electric passenger car, frame structure including base plate and side shield, backboard composition, the upper surface of described base plate, side shield and backboard are collectively forming the containing cavity for placing battery case, described base plate is provided with gathering sill, the protrusions of this gathering sill and battery case, the front end of described gathering sill is opening shape, and rear end is closed, arranges and be disposed with running roller on described base plate.When carrying out battery case installation, the projection on battery case and gathering sill match, and battery case is put into base plate from the side of gathering sill opening, and under the effect of running roller, workman only need to apply only small external force and battery case can be promoted to move on base plate.
Preferably, being provided with buffer spring in described gathering sill, described buffer spring one end is arranged on the perpendicular of gathering sill blind end, and the other end is free end.Buffer spring had both played cushioning effect, it is prevented that battery case owing to power is excessive, causes the collision deformation to battery case in progradation, and battery case can play again pressuring action, simple in construction.
Preferably, being provided with block on described base plate, this block is positioned at the opening position of gathering sill.After battery case puts in place, block is used to be fixed the position of battery case, it is to avoid battery case slides.
Preferably, described block is connected with base plate by screw.Use screw connect, simple in construction, easy to connect reliably.
Preferably, it is respectively arranged with reinforcement plate at four corner position places of described base plate, described reinforcement plate is provided with fixing hole for base plate is fixedly connected on vehicle body.Strengthen plate and both base plate can have been played the effect of reinforcement, can be easy to arrange fixing hole on this reinforcement plate again simultaneously, facilitate the mounting structure of whole battery case to fix with vehicle body and be connected.
Preferably, between side shield and the backboard at the left and right two ends of described base plate, it is provided with buttress brace.Buttress brace is set, plays booster action for side dams and backboard, it is ensured that the reliability of the mounting structure of whole battery case.
Compared with prior art, the beneficial effects of the utility model are: by arranging gathering sill on base plate, and the protrusions on described gathering sill and battery case, when installing battery case, gathering sill can play guiding and the effect of location, it is prevented that battery case is put askew;It addition, by arranging running roller on base plate, when only needing only small thrust can promote battery case on base plate, facilitate the installation of battery case.This utility model simple in construction, it is simple to promote the use of in electric motor coach.
